10分钟快速掌握PLD设计:三人表决器实现

需积分: 9 7 下载量 91 浏览量 更新于2024-08-02 收藏 989KB DOC 举报
"10分钟学会PLD设计文档是一个针对初学者的PLD开发教程,旨在帮助读者在短时间内掌握PLD设计的基本流程。教程通过设计一个简单的三人表决器为例,涵盖了VHDL、Verilog-HDL和原理图输入三种方式,并指导如何在Max+plusII 10.2软件中进行设计、仿真和下载到实验板进行实际操作。实验所需硬件包括PC、JX002B型实验板、电源和下载电缆。" 在PLD设计中,可编程逻辑器件(PLD)是一种灵活的电子元件,能够根据用户定义的逻辑功能进行配置。这个10分钟学会PLD设计的教程首先介绍了实验目标,即使用PLD设计一个三人表决器,其功能是根据三个输入开关的状态决定是红灯(L1)亮还是黄灯(L2)亮,从而表示决议是否通过。表决器的逻辑表达式通过卡诺图化简得到,便于在设计中实现。 教程中提到了所需的软件环境,即Max+plusII 10.2,这是一个广泛使用的PLD设计工具,包含设计输入、仿真和编程等功能。对于初学者,教程提供了软件安装、license获取以及下载电缆驱动程序的链接,确保用户能够顺利进行实验。 设计输入部分详细讲解了如何使用原理图方式设计三人表决器。在Max+plusII中,用户需要创建新的图形文件,然后插入必要的逻辑门元件(如AND2、OR3、NOT)和输入输出端口。教程特别指出,对于已熟悉的操作,文档会简略处理,专注于关键步骤。 此外,教程还暗示后续章节将涵盖VHDL和Verilog-HDL这两种硬件描述语言的设计方法,这两种语言是描述和实现数字逻辑电路的常用编程语言。通过这种方式,学习者可以对比理解不同设计方法的优缺点,进一步巩固PLD设计技能。 这个教程为初学者提供了一个快速入门PLD设计的途径,通过实际操作和理论结合,帮助他们在短时间内理解PLD的工作原理和设计流程。尽管标题声称10分钟就能学会,但全面掌握PLD设计可能需要更长时间的实践和学习。